A message from the new West High Activites Director- Gabe Hoogers!
My name is Gabe Hoogers, and pictured with me is my wife Kelsey. We also have a 9 month old daughter, Makenna. I grew up in Sioux City, attending North High School before heading to Wayne State College for my post-secondary education. My family is deeply rooted in Sioux City and we love everything the Sioux City Schools have to offer for their students and the community.
For the past four years, I have taught Science at West High School and served as the Head Baseball Coach. During that time, I have witnessed firsthand the tremendous things our students at West High School take part in on a daily basis, and I can't wait to support and showcase our students' talents and achievements in my new role. West High Activities have a special place in my heart and I am honored and excited to serve West High School as the new Activities Director.
LAPTOP CHECK-OUT DAYS: August 9 and August 10
Students and families are invited to West High School on Wednesday, August 9 from 8am-4pm, and Thursday, August 10, from 10am-6pm. On those days, the following events & support will be available:
- Laptop Check-out
- Online Verification Support
- School Fees
- Food Service Fees
- Diploma Verification
- Schedule Change Requests
- WITCC Course Log-in Support
Students who are not able to attend on these days to check-out their laptop will have an opportunity to do so on the first day of school, Wednesday, August 23rd. *We will not be able to accommodate other arrangements.

2023-2024 Student Schedules
The 2023-2024 Schedule is still being created. Student schedules will not be ready for review by students and families until late July or early August. When schedules are ready for viewing, additional communication will be shared.
All 2023-2024 West High students will have an opportunity to meet with their counselor regarding schedule change requests on Wednesday, August 9, from 8am-4pm, and on Thursday August 10, from 10am-6pm. A liaison from WITCC will also be available to help with login support for students who are registered for WITCC courses.
In the meantime, if students have questions about their schedule, they are encouraged to email their school counselor.

West High Food Pantry & Closet
The West High School Food Pantry & Clothing Closet is available to meet the needs the West side community. We can assist families with meals, clothing, toiletries, and some household goods.
